.events-page{display:flex;flex-direction:column;justify-content:center;align-items:center;flex-wrap:nowrap}.events-page h1{color:#131515;font-family:var(--primary-font-family);font-size:35px;font-weight:500;text-align:center;padding:50px 0;margin:0}.events-page .title{color:#131515;font-family:var(--primary-font-family);font-size:18px;font-weight:400;text-align:center;line-height:26px;margin-bottom:0}.events-page .section-1{width:calc(100% - 180px);margin:0 0 70px;border-radius:4px;background-color:#fff;padding:70px 100px}.events-page .section-banner{width:100%;text-align:center;margin:0 auto}.events-page .section-banner img{width:400px}.events-page .section-2{position:relative;width:100%;margin:70px 0;padding:50px;background-color:#5c068c;display:flex;flex-direction:row;flex-wrap:nowrap;column-gap:30px;justify-content:center;align-items:center}.events-page .section-2 .screen-shot{width:100%}.events-page .section-2 .screen-link{flex:33.33%;max-width:33.33%}.events-page .section-2 .video-full,.events-page .section-2 .youtube-placeholder-wrapper{width:280px;height:450px}.events-page .section-2 .video-full>iframe,.events-page .section-2 .youtube-placeholder-wrapper>iframe{padding:0}.events-page .section-2 .video-full .youtube-placeholder-wrapper,.events-page .section-2 .youtube-placeholder-wrapper .youtube-placeholder-wrapper{height:100%;background-color:#fff}.events-page .section-2 .video-full .youtube-placeholder-wrapper .ico,.events-page .section-2 .youtube-placeholder-wrapper .youtube-placeholder-wrapper .ico{background-color:#131515}.events-page .section-3{width:calc(100% - 100px);margin:0 0 90px;border:2px solid #FF8200;border-radius:4px;background-color:#fff;display:flex;flex-direction:column;flex-wrap:nowrap;justify-content:center;align-items:center;padding:100px}.events-page .section-3 .review-link{display:flex;flex-direction:row;flex-wrap:nowrap;justify-content:center;align-items:center;height:70px;margin-top:40px;border-radius:4px;background-color:#ff8200;padding:0 40px;color:#131515;font-family:var(--secondary-font-family);font-size:18px;font-weight:600;letter-spacing:-.2px;white-space:nowrap}.events-page .section-3 .review-link:hover,.events-page .section-3 .review-link:focus{text-decoration:none;background-color:#131515;color:#fff}@media (max-width: 991.98px){.events-page .h1{font-size:30px}.events-page .section-1{width:calc(100% - 100px);margin:0 0 60px;padding:40px 50px}.events-page .banner{width:300px}.events-page .section-2{padding:50px 38px;column-gap:10px}.events-page .section-3{width:calc(100% - 100px);margin:0 0 70px;padding:40px 50px}.events-page .section-3 .review-link{font-size:16px;margin-top:30px;padding:0 30px}.events-page .title{font-size:14px}}@media (max-width: 767.98px){.events-page h1{font-size:26px;padding:40px 0}.events-page .section-1{width:calc(100% - 40px);padding:40px 35px;font-size:14px;margin:0 0 50px}.events-page .section-banner img{width:200px}.events-page .section-2{flex-direction:row;flex-wrap:nowrap;justify-content:center;align-items:center;padding:40px 10px;row-gap:15px}.events-page .section-2 .screen-link{flex:0 1 240px;max-width:240px}.events-page .section-2 .screen-shot{flex:100%;width:224px;height:400px;border:1px solid red}.events-page .section-2 .own-swiper{height:400px;position:relative}.events-page .section-2 .own-swiper .own-swiper-body{padding:0 10px 0 20px}.events-page .section-2 .own-swiper .own-swiper-slide{padding-left:20px;margin-left:-20px;padding-right:10px}.events-page .section-2 .own-swiper .own-swiper-slide .screen-link{display:flex;width:240px;max-width:unset}.events-page .section-3{padding:40px 35px;font-size:14px;width:calc(100% - 40px)}.events-page .section-3 .review-link{height:50px;margin-top:30px;padding:0 20px}}
